Binance Market Dominance Plunges: A Deep Dive Into The 36% Share Drop
According to a recent report by Bloomberg, Binance, the world’s largest cryptocurrency exchange by trading volume, is facing significant challenges as its market share continues to decline.  In September, Binance’s share of trading volume in the roughly $2 trillion digital asset market fell to 36.6%, down sharply from 42.7% at the start of the year and the lowest level in four years, according to data from CCData. Binance Spot And Derivatives Trading Hits Four-Year Lows The drop in market share is particularly pronounced in both the spot and derivatives trading arenas. Binance’s 27% share of the spot market represents its lowest level since January 2021, while its derivatives trading share stands at 40.7%, also the lowest in four years.
